<p>The big-headed ant, <i>Pheidole megacephala</i>, is an ecologically disruptive invader of tropical and subtropical environments worldwide. In April 2014 an established infestation of <i>P. megacephala</i> was discovered in a residential neighborhood in Costa Mesa, Orange County, California, and in 2019 a second infestation was found in a residential neighborhood (Talmadge / City Heights) in San Diego, San Diego County, California. Although big-headed ants are regularly detected in commerce in California, the records from Costa Mesa and Talmadge / City Heights represent the first established infestations documented from the state. In 2024 and 2025, four additional infestations were discovered or confirmed in other residential neighborhoods in San Diego. To assess whether or not <i>P. megacephala</i> will expand its range in this region, we delineated infestations in Costa Mesa and Talmadge / City Heights in 2023 and 2024 and compared this species to another widespread invader, the Argentine ant (<i>Linepithema humile</i>), with respect to desiccation tolerance and δ15N. The delineated <i>P. megacephala</i> infestations extend over multiple hectares of suburban and urban development, with the Talmadge / City Heights infestation exceeding 100&#xa0;ha and the Costa Mesa infestation exceeding 10&#xa0;ha. Between 2023 and 2024 the size of the Talmadge / City Heights infestation increased by 12&#xa0;ha. Comparisons of the two focal species revealed overlapping δ15N values and estimates of desiccation tolerance. Our findings indicate that established populations of <i>P. megacephala</i> will continue to spread in urban environments in coastal southern California and potentially cause impacts comparable to those resulting from invasion by the Argentine ant.</p>
